1. 数据恢复的重要性
在数字化时代,数据对于个人和企业的价值不言而喻。然而,数据丢失的风险也无处不在。无论是硬件故障、软件错误,还是人为操作失误,都有可能导致数据的意外丢失。掌握MySQL数据恢复技巧,不仅能帮助企业挽回损失,还能避免因数据丢失导致的业务中断。
2. MySQL数据恢复原理
MySQL数据恢复主要基于以下两个原理:
- 备份与恢复:通过定期备份MySQL数据库,当数据丢失时,可以从备份中恢复数据。
- 数据损坏修复:当数据库文件损坏时,通过相应的修复工具和技术来修复数据。
3. MySQL数据恢复步骤
以下是MySQL数据恢复的详细步骤:
3.1 数据备份
- 全量备份:定期对MySQL数据库进行全量备份,确保数据的完整性。
- 增量备份:在每次全量备份后,对变化的数据进行增量备份,减少备份所需的时间和空间。
3.2 数据恢复
- 检查备份:在恢复数据前,先检查备份文件的完整性。
- 选择恢复模式:根据数据丢失的原因和需求,选择合适的恢复模式。例如,部分数据丢失可以选择部分恢复,数据库损坏可以选择完整恢复。
- 执行恢复操作:使用MySQL提供的工具(如
mysql命令行工具)或第三方恢复工具进行数据恢复。
4. 实战案例详解
4.1 备份失败导致的丢失
案例背景
某企业数据库管理员在进行全量备份时,误将备份路径设置错误,导致备份文件丢失。
解决方案
- 查找误删除的备份文件:在备份路径的上级目录中查找误删除的备份文件。
- 恢复备份文件:将误删除的备份文件复制到正确的备份路径下。
- 使用备份文件恢复数据库:使用MySQL提供的工具或第三方恢复工具,从备份文件中恢复数据库。
4.2 硬盘损坏导致的丢失
案例背景
某企业数据库服务器硬盘出现故障,导致数据库文件损坏。
解决方案
- 备份损坏的数据库文件:将损坏的数据库文件复制到安全的位置。
- 使用第三方修复工具:使用MySQL提供的工具或第三方修复工具修复损坏的数据库文件。
- 使用修复后的文件恢复数据库:使用MySQL提供的工具或第三方恢复工具,从修复后的数据库文件中恢复数据库。
5. 总结
掌握MySQL数据恢复技巧,能帮助企业降低数据丢失风险,确保业务的正常运行。通过以上实战案例详解,相信大家已经对MySQL数据恢复有了更深入的了解。在日常工作中,请务必养成良好的数据备份习惯,确保数据安全。
